The Meaning and Origin of Franqui At its heart, Franqui means "free man." This evocative meaning traces back to the Old French and Latin roots linked to the Franks, a Germanic people known for their freedom and strength. The name resonates strongly in Spanish-speaking cultures, where it’s embraced as a symbol of independence and self-determination.

Fun Facts and Trivia Did you know that Franqui is also a common surname in the Dominican Republic? This crossover between surname and given name enriches its cultural tapestry.
Moreover, the name’s variations and nicknames — like Frank, Frankie, Franquito, and Quiqui — offer delightful options for personal expression.
Modern Usage and Trends While Franqui isn’t among the most common names, its uniqueness appeals to parents seeking a meaningful yet uncommon name. It bridges traditional Spanish roots with a contemporary desire for individuality.
